This opportunity is based at a brand-new, advanced biologics manufacturing plant. The site features a cutting-edge FleX Batch facility that combines the latest in disposable technologies with traditional stainless-steel systems, enabling maximum operational flexibility. The facility integrates best-in-class manufacturing processes and industry 4.0 capabilities, along with sustainability initiatives designed to reduce carbon emissions and waste.

Responsibilities:
In this role, the Engineer will report to the Senior Manager of the Process Engineering group and will provide daily engineering support to the site. Responsibilities include:
  • Serve as system owner for process equipment and systems supporting manufacturing operations.
  • Provide engineering support for design, construction, startup, commissioning, and qualification of new or modified systems.
  • Identify and/or lead implementation of small-to-medium scale equipment or facility improvements, including development of business cases.
  • Develop maintenance programs, ensure spare part availability, and coordinate execution to maintain system reliability.
  • Ensure systems operate safely and in compliance with EHS standards and regulations.
  • Support commissioning and qualification activities in alignment with GMP requirements and regulatory inspections.
  • Apply engineering principles in daily operations, maintenance, and troubleshooting of plant systems.
  • Monitor system performance and implement risk-reduction strategies.
  • Lead or support troubleshooting efforts to minimize production downtime, including root cause analysis and CAPA implementation.
  • Support new product and technology introductions via engineering assessments, equipment modifications, and pilot runs.
  • Advance use of predictive maintenance and condition-based monitoring using data analytics where applicable.
  • Lead or contribute to deviation investigations and other quality-related processes.
  • Analyze and present findings related to operational issues and engineering projects.
  • Provide technical support to commercial and clinical manufacturing, specifically in process control and equipment.
  • Collaborate with cross-functional groups such as manufacturing, process development, utilities, maintenance, quality, and validation to drive operational improvements.
  • Maintain regular communication with leadership and team members, escalating issues with proposed solutions.
  • Participate in a small engineering team on a project or ongoing support basis.
  • Provide rotational on-call support for utility systems, including nights, weekends, and holidays as needed.
  • Participate in the design and selection of systems, instrumentation, and components.
  • Evaluate supplier capabilities and assess new technologies to improve cost, throughput, or technical capabilities.
